A leading global communications agency is seeking a Senior Talent Acquisition Partner focused on recruiting and onboarding emerging talent. You will manage a team of Recruiters to ensure rigorous and efficient recruitment processes, enhance candidate onboarding experiences, and foster talent pipelines from programs to open roles.
This role requires significant experience in high-volume recruitment and strong stakeholder management skills. The agency offers a hybrid work model, competitive benefits, and emphasizes diversity and inclusion.
